;*******************************************************
;	Set up Vesa 2
;*******************************************************

NEWSYM InitVesa2
	   ;-------------------------------------------------;
	    ; First - allocate some bytes in DOS memory for ;
	    ; communication with VBE			    ;
	   ;-------------------------------------------------;

	mov eax,0100h
	mov ebx,512/16			; 512 bytes
	int 31h				; Function 31h,100h - Allocate
					; DOS memory (512 bytes)
	jnc .gotmem
	    mov edx,.nomemmessage
            jmp VESA2EXITTODOS
	    .nomemmessage
            db 'Unable to locate DOS memory.',0

	.gotmem
	mov fs,dx			; FS now points to the DOS
					; buffer


	   ;--------------------------------------------------;
	    ; Now, get information about the video card into ;
	    ; a data structure				     ;
	   ;--------------------------------------------------;

	mov edi,RMREGS
        mov dword[fs:0],'VBE2'          ; Request VBE 2.0 info
	mov dword[RMREGS.eax],4f00h
	mov word[RMREGS.es],ax		; Real mode segment of DOS 
					; buffer
	mov dword[RMREGS.edi],0

	push es
        push ds
	pop es
	mov eax,300h
	mov ebx,10h
	xor ecx,ecx
	int 31h				; Simulate real mode interrupt
	pop es

	jnc .int1ok
	    mov edx,.noint1message
            jmp VESA2EXITTODOS
	    .noint1message
            db 'Simulated real mode interrupt failed.',0

	.int1ok			; Real mode int successful!!!
	mov eax,[RMREGS.eax]
	cmp al,4fh		; Check vbe interrupt went OK
	jz .vbedetected
	    mov edx,.novbemessage
            jmp VESA2EXITTODOS
	    .novbemessage
            db 'VBE not detected!!',0

	.vbedetected
	cmp dword[fs:0000],'VESA'
	jz .vesadetected	; Check for presence of vesa
	    mov edx,.novesamessage
            jmp VESA2EXITTODOS
	    .novesamessage
            db 'VESA not detected!',0

	.vesadetected
	cmp word[fs:0004],200h
	jae .vesa2detected	; Check we've got VESA 2.0 or greater
	    mov edx,.novesa2message
            jmp VESA2EXITTODOS
	    .novesa2message
            db 'VESA 2.0 or greater required!',0


		;-----------------------------------------------------;
		 ; OK - vesa 2.0 or greater has been detected. Copy  ;
		 ; mode information into VESAmodelist		     ;
		;-----------------------------------------------------;

	.vesa2detected
        mov dword[vesa3en],0
        cmp word[fs:004],300h
        jb .notvbe3
        mov dword[vesa3en],1
        .notvbe3
	mov ax,[fs:12h]			; Get no. of 64k blocks
	mov [noblocks],ax
	mov ax, 2
	mov bx,[fs:10h]
	int 31h

	jnc .wegottheselector
	    mov edx, .oopsnoselector
            jmp VESA2EXITTODOS
	    .oopsnoselector
                db 'Failed to allocate vesa display selector!',0

	.wegottheselector

	mov gs,ax
	xor eax,eax
	mov ebp,VESAmodelist
	mov ecx,512
	mov ax,[fs:0eh]

	.loopcopymodes
	    mov bx,[gs:eax]
	    mov [ebp],bx
	    cmp bx,0ffffh
	    jz .copiedmodes
	    add ebp,2
	    add eax,2
	    dec ecx
	    jz .outofmodelistspace
	    jmp .loopcopymodes

		.outofmodelistspace
		mov edx,.outofmodelistspacemessage
                jmp VESA2EXITTODOS
		.outofmodelistspacemessage
                db 'Out of VESA2 mode list space!',0

		   ;----------------------------------------------;
		    ; OK - Scan the mode list to find a matching ;
		    ; mode for vesa2_x, vesa2_y and vesa2_depth	 ;
		   ;----------------------------------------------;

    .copiedmodes

	mov ebp,VESAmodelist
	xor ecx,ecx

    .loopcheckmodes
	mov cx, [ebp]
	cmp cx, 0ffffh
	jnz .notendoflist

	    mov edx,.endoflist
            jmp VESA2EXITTODOS

            .endoflist db 'This VESA2 mode does not work on your video card / driver.',0
            .whichwin db 0

    .notendoflist

        mov edi, RMREGS
        mov dword[RMREGS.eax],4f01h
        mov dword[RMREGS.ebx],0
        mov dword[RMREGS.ecx],ecx
        mov dword[RMREGS.edi],0

	push es
        push ds
	pop es
	mov eax,300h
	mov ebx,10h
	xor ecx,ecx
	int 31h				; Simulate real mode interrupt
	pop es
	jnc .modecheckok
	    mov edx,.modecheckfail
            jmp VESA2EXITTODOS
	    .modecheckfail
            db 'Real mode interrupt failure while checking vesa mode',0

	.modecheckok
	add ebp,2

        test word[fs:0000h],1b
            jz near .loopcheckmodes     ; If mode is not available
